CI note — Bouncewright pipeline flake. Heads up: the Bouncewright email bounce processor keeps failing its integration stage because the mock SMTP fixture on the Tarnholm runners boots slower than the test timeout. It's not a real regression — the parser itself passes fine locally and on the Ashgrove runners. Quick fix for this release: bump the fixture wait from 10s to 30s in the stage config and re-trigger. If you see three greens in a row, you're clear to cut the release using the build token below.

build token for haduf-bafog: htk21_2d98ce91a83676b65394a

## Resizing batches with `thumbler`

Plugin authors: `thumbler batch` takes a manifest, a target profile, and an output dir. Keep batches under 500 images or the worker pool gets cranky. Exit code 3 means a corrupt source file, not a plugin bug. Full flag reference and profile syntax are documented on our internal page.

wiki page, tahaf-tajog: https://jira.ordindyn.corp/pipeline

## Who to ping about GiftNote

Welcome aboard! GiftNote is our donation-receipt mailer for the Larchfield Fund. Template tweaks go to the comms folks; delivery failures and bounce weirdness go to the platform crew. Don't push template changes on Fridays — receipts batch over the weekend. For anything GiftNote-related, start with the address below.

billing contact of kaweg-tajeg = drudor.lamion.oliath@torvalabs.test